Real World Guide to Happiness is very interesting and enlightening. The author keeps the reading light andinteresting leaving the reader wanting to continue. This is a great book that people carry with them or have it near by to refer to in their daily lives. It's not only a book that helps when you are struggling with life, but can also lift your spirits on a daily basis. The book, while reading it, helps you to focus on the positive things in life or how to achieve happiness and serenity in your daily trials. I would have loved to have, had several copies of this book to give to various friends and family. The author's use of words makes it easy for anyone to read and understand. Author, Mary Jesse incorporates humor along with the serious, which makes the book easy to read. The reading level is appropriate for a high fourth grade reading level and up. I highly recommend Real World Guide to Happiness for anyone wanting a positive impact on his or her life. Sherry Kruegel, reviewer for Betsie's Literary Page

ISBN: 0-9729958-1-1Title: Real World Guide To Happiness Author: Mary Jesse Publisher: Hexagon Blue The saying `good things come in small packages' holds especially true for Mary Jesse's 64 page book "Real World Guide To Happiness." Jesse's guide, while short, is succinct, easily read, and brilliantly achievable. The author's excellent verbal skill is apparent in her concise style and complete comprehension of her subject, happiness. With such sayings as - `Nice guys do not finish last. Some people are just confused about the location of the finish line,' - Mary Jesse draws readers into her realm of thinking. A quick but accurate accounting of "Real World Guide To Happiness" can be obtained by reviewing the condensed italicized tenets throughout the book. "Real World Guide To Happiness" - a emotion all of us are interested in attaining - is the perfect size for carrying in your pocket or purse. Jesse's book is excellent for sharing and would make a great gift for family or friends. Good job, Jesse! Beverly J Scott author of "Righteous Revenge" and "Ruth Fever."
